I'd go with LA Choppers. Their 6-7" drags are almost like stock. Their 9-9.5 give a nice pullback increase (I'm 5'10" and in the increased pullback of the 9.5" was perfect). You'll also want to consider if you need new lines. Some folks can keep the stock lines with 9" pull. I had to replace my lines with 9.5" pullback only because of the clutch line.
